What happened
Landlord applied for an order to terminate the tenancy and evict Tenant due to failure to pay rent. The application was filed after serving a valid Notice to End Tenancy Early for Non-payment of Rent (N4 Notice), which the Tenant did not void by paying the arrears. The Tenant had vacated the rental unit on September 20, 2020, prior to the hearing date.
The ruling
The tenancy is terminated as of April 30, 2021 on consent of the parties. The Tenant must pay the Landlord $11,978.21, which includes rent arrears, compensation for use of the unit, and the application fee, less the rent deposit and interest. If the Tenant does not pay the full amount by October 30, 2021, they will owe interest. The Landlord may file the order with the Sheriff for enforcement if the unit is not vacated by April 30, 2021.
